| Comments: |
some fast and frozen redlining on the cranmore and black cap connector trails. cranmore was making snow, but trails snow free. went up the service road to the summit (2+miles) to pick up the cranmore trail and loop down black cap connector to the service road. some frozen leaves, frost heaves, and ice in the low wet spots, but easy enough to get around without spikes. blazing is light, but footbed easily followed. black cap connector is a wide trail, because it is also a snow mobile trail...and used by mountain bikers too. only one blowdown about 8" in diameter on black cap connector. i moved aside all other trippers. after the junction with black cap connector and the spur path to thompson road, i BW'd thru the woods and across the brook back to the service road and to car. RT 8mi 3 hours and then i met up with friends at Redstone Quarry, which is a pretty cool place to explore. |
